Instructions

For the Onions:

  • Melt the butter in a small skillet over medium heat.
  • Add the onions.
  • Cover and cook for 10-15 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the onions are soft.
  • Then uncover and cook for an additional 5 minutes until the excess liquid cooks off.  Deglaze the pan with the beer.

For the Sauce:

  • Mix together the sauce ingredients in a small bowl.  Cover and refrigerate until ready to use.

For the Burgers:

  • Preheat a grill over medium heat (approximately 350-400 degrees F).
  • Form the beef into 4 patties that are approximately ½ pound each.
  • Place on the grill over direct heat. Season the patties with salt, pepper and garlic powder.
  • Cook for 5-6 minutes per side until the patties reach an internal temperature of 165 degrees F.
  • Place a slice of cheese on the patties for the last minute of the cooking time to melt the cheese.
  • Butter the pretzel buns and place them on the grill for approximately 1 minute to toast the buns.
  • Remove the buns. Spread the burger sauce on the buns.
  • Serve the patties on the buns topped with the caramelized onions and enjoy!
